Top Tattoo Studios You Should Know
Several standout studios have emerged as leaders in the St. Louis tattoo scene:
- Thirteen Roses Tattoo & Aesthetics: Located in Maryland Heights, this studio has garnered rave reviews for its talented artists like Rachelle, who creates stunning, detailed work.
- Lucky Cat Studio: A unique, majority-female tattoo parlor on Arsenal Street that offers a welcoming and inclusive atmosphere. They're known for their privacy options and well-lit workspace.
- Pastel Devil Studio: Situated on Chouteau Avenue, this bright and feminine studio stands out for its refreshing approach to tattoo artistry.
- Ragtime Tattoo: Located on Morgan Ford Road, this studio is praised for clean, precise work and exceptional healing processes.
What to Consider When Choosing a Tattoo Studio
When selecting a tattoo studio in St. Louis, consider these key factors:
- Artist Portfolio: Review each artist's previous work to ensure their style matches your vision
- Studio Cleanliness: A professional, clean environment is crucial for safe tattooing
- Consultation Process: Look for studios that offer detailed consultations and welcome your input
- Specialization: Some studios excel in specific styles like fine line, traditional, or custom designs

Walk-In and Appointment Options
St. Louis tattoo studios offer flexible booking methods. For instance, Alchemy Tattoo Collective provides walk-in options Tuesday through Sunday from 11 AM to 7 PM at their Central West End location. However, complex designs typically require scheduled appointments.

Are there age restrictions for tattoos?
+
In Missouri, you must be at least 18 years old to get a tattoo. Parental consent is not an alternative – a valid government-issued ID is required to prove age.
